Madison Blair pitched a six-hitter Thursday as Harlan County rolled to a 9-4 win over visiting Hazard.

A four-run first inning by her offense was enough for Harlan County pitcher Madison Blair on Thursday as she scattered six hits while walking only one in the Lady Bears’ 9-4 win over visiting Hazard.
After giving up a run in the first inning, Blair shut out the Lady Dogs until giving up two runs in the seventh.
Halle Raleigh led the HCHS offense with a triple and single. Jade Burton singled twice. Halanah Shepherd added a triple. Blair, Rylie Maggard and Jenna Wilson contributed one single each.
Alexa Muha led the 11-10 Lady Dogs with a triple and two singles. Mallory Combs, Ryleigh Griffith and Jocelyn Mullins had one single each.
Blair led off the game with a single and Wilson was hit by a pitch before Burton drove in a run with a single and Shepherd followed with an RBI triple.Two runs scored on errors as the Lady Bears took a 4-1 lead.
Burton and Maggard had singles in the third inning as the HCHS lead grew to 5-1. Raleigh tripled in the fourth inning and came around to score on an errant throw that bounced past third base.
Raleigh and Wilson had hits in the sixth inning as the Lady Bears extended their advantage to 9-1.

The Lady Bears rolled to a 19-8 six-inning win Friday at Barbourville.
Brittleigh Estep drove in five runs on two doubles and a single. Halanah Shepherd added three singles. Jade Burton and Rylie Maggard each had a double and single. Madison Blair, Halle Raleigh, Hailey Austin and Lesleigh Brown contributed two singles each. Jenna Wilson added one single. Shepherd, Austin and Maggard scored three runs each.
Blair was the winning pitcher, giving up eight runs (three earned) on 12 hits with five strikeouts and three walks.
Harlan County (9-16) will travel to Harlan on Monday.
